Why we included this project
Anyone shipping code that touches LLM agents, MCP servers, or AI-assisted workflows is trusting a growing pile of third-party components, and that trust carries a class of risk older scanners were never built to catch: poisoned repositories, leaked API keys sitting in prompt history, and compromised coding hooks. MEDUSA is a scanner aimed squarely at that gap, with more than 40,000 detection patterns that cover AI supply chain attacks alongside familiar targets like Log4Shell and Spring4Shell. You can point it at a repository to learn what you are about to clone, scan your Claude or Cursor setup for exposed keys and suspicious hooks, or run a plain scan over an existing codebase with no configuration. It installs from PyPI as a single command-line tool, so a small team without a dedicated security engineer can screen what it is about to rely on without much ceremony.
